X

A Digital Signature Certificate (DSC): What is it?

A digital token issued by a Certifying Authority (CA), such as Emudhra, Capricorn, or Pantasign, that uses cryptographic keys to verify a person’s identity and safeguard the integrity of electronic documents is called a Digital Signature Certificate (DSC). A DSC is required for safe online submissions such as ITR, GST, company registration, e-tenders, and so on, and it has the same legal standing as a handwritten signature.

How Does the Online DSC Application Process Work?

  1. Speak with a DSC Authorized Agent. These brokers offer a paperless method of purchasing DSCs and could even assist in selecting the appropriate certificate class and validity duration.
  2. Verify your e-KYC. You must use Aadhaar or PAN-based e-KYC to verify your identity. Supporting documentation may need to be uploaded, verified in person, or verified by video, depending on the option selected.

Typical documents include:

Photo ID: voter ID, passport, or Aadhaar

Proof of address: bank statement, utility bill

The PAN card

A passport-sized photograph

It’s possible that certain CAs will insist on an e-verification via recorded video utilizing the original documents.

Select DSC Validity & Class. Choose the DSC form according to its intended use:

Class 1: Basic validation at the email level.

Class 2: Requires adherence to company regulations or income tax.

Class 3: Required for safe operations like online bidding and tendering

Choose whether the certificate is “Signature only,” “Encryption only,” or “Combo.” Validity options are typically 1, 2, or 3 years.

    Complete the online payment.

    Choose a secure online payment option, such as a credit card, debit card, net banking, or UPI, after deciding on your DSC type and validity. Rates vary according to issuer, validity, and DSC class.

    Verify your identity.

    Your selected class and CA may require biometric or video-based identification verification. The DSC is released following successful completion and processing.

      Get and download DSC. Following issuance, the DSC can be provided as a USB token or emailed for download via email.

      In order to install the certificate on your computer system, tokens frequently include optional middleware software (like eSigner).

      How to Register Your DSC (such as Income Tax and GST) on the E-Filing Portal Registering your DSC for usage on official websites:If you haven’t previously, install the eSigner application.

      Enter your login information to access the relevant site (e-Filing or GST). On My Profile, select Register/Update DSC.

      After selecting your CA provider and certificate, confirm that eSigner is installed, then click Sign.

      A confirmation message will be sent to you following a successful validation. If your certificate has been updated or is about to expire, you can also re-register or renew.

      Last Thoughts & Advice

      DSC validity: Be mindful—renewal is a rerun of the verification and e-KYC process.

      Use of certificates:

      Class 3 is necessary for high-security operations like tenders, whereas Class 2 is sufficient for most tax and MCA returns.

      Security: Keep your token, login PIN, and DSC secure because their unlawful usage raises questions about their legitimacy.

        • Share This :
        Yash Sharma